Maximize Space: Small Kitchen Cabinet Solutions

In a small kitchen, every inch of space counts. Make the most of your limited storage by implementing these clever cabinet tips. Employ vertical space with risers and shelf organizers to create more levels within cabinets. Consider adding pull-out shelves for easy access to items in the back of cabinets. To maximize storage even further, think about using stackable containers and drawer dividers to keep everything neat and arranged.

  • Use clear containers so you can easily see what's inside.
  • Attach pots and pans from the ceiling or wall to free up cabinet space.
  • Choose cabinets with doors that swing both ways to improve accessibility.

With a little innovation, you can transform your small kitchen cabinets into efficient storage powerhouses.

Kitchen Cabinet Hardware: The Finishing Touch

Whether you're updating your kitchen or simply craving a fresh look, the right cabinet hardware can truly make a difference. It's a essential detail that can elevate your entire space, adding a dash of personality and style. From classic knobs to trendy pendants, there's a wide array of options to match your kitchen's design aesthetic. Don't underestimate the impact of these tiny touches—they can transform your cabinets from ordinary to extraordinary.

Think about the overall style of your kitchen when selecting hardware. A rustic kitchen might benefit from distressed finishes, while a modern space could excel with minimalist, geometric designs.

  • Consider the size and shape of your cabinets when making your choice.
  • Sturdy hardware is ideal for wide cabinets, while smaller pulls work well on petite doors.
  • Experiment with different materials and finishes to create a truly unique look.

Remember, the right kitchen cabinet hardware can be the final flourish that brings your entire design together.
